Products
96SEO 2025-07-15 16:40 1
HBase作为一种流行的非关系型分布式数据库,已成为存储一巨大堆数据和实现飞迅速查询的关键。只是在CentOS操作系统下HBase的性能瓶颈兴许会关系到其稳稳当当性和效率。
结实件材料是关系到HBase性能的关键因素。包括CPU、内存、磁盘I/O和网络带宽阔等。如果结实件材料不够,兴许会成为性能瓶颈。
HBase的配置参数对性能有关键关系到。不合理的配置兴许会弄得材料浪费或性能减少。比方说内存配置、RegionServer配置等。
数据模型设计不当兴许会弄得查询效率矮小下从而关系到整体性能。合理的表结构设计能搞优良查询速度和少许些存储地方。
索引和查询优化是搞优良HBase性能的关键。通过合理的索引策略和查询优化,能显著搞优良查询速度。
1. 升级结实件设备:根据需求升级CPU、内存、磁盘I/O和网络带宽阔等结实件设备,以搞优良系统性能。
2. 优化结实件配置:合理配置结实件材料,避免材料浪费。
1. 优化内存配置:调整HBase的内存配置, 比方说RegionServer的内存巨大细小、Region的最巨大巨大细小等。
2. 优化RegionServer配置:调整RegionServer的配置, 比方说Region的数量、Region的副本数等。
1. 优化表结构:合理设计表结构,避免冗余字段和麻烦的关联关系。
2. 优化数据存储:根据数据特点选择合适的存储策略,比方说用压缩存储或二级索引。
1. 优化索引策略:根据查询需求选择合适的索引策略, 比方说B树索引、全索引等。
2. 优化查询语句:优化查询语句,避免麻烦的关联查询和子查询。
系统监控和维护是确保HBase稳稳当当运行的关键。
1. 监控CPU、 内存、磁盘I/O和网络带宽阔等结实件材料的用情况。
2. 监控HBase的读写求、RegionServer状态等性能指标。
1. 定期检查HBase的配置参数,确保其合理性和有效性。
2. ,以优化性能。
1. 定期清理HBase中的过期数据和无效数据,以释放存储地方。
2. 定期进行数据压缩,以搞优良查询速度。
在CentOS上优化HBase的性能需要综合考虑结实件材料、配置参数、数据模型和系统监控等优良几个方面。通过合理的优化措施,能有效解决HBase的性能瓶颈,搞优良其稳稳当当性和效率。
Demand feedback